About Kabinda
Situated in DR Congo's Lomami region, Kabinda is a city that forms an important part of the local area. The city's population stands at approximately 219,396, reflecting its role as a significant regional hub.
The city's coordinates — 6.14°S, 24.48°E — place it in the Southern Eastern Hemisphere. All local activities follow the Africa/Lubumbashi timezone. The city's location within the temperate zone affords it a climate broadly suited to both agriculture and urban life.
